

Intravenous (IV) iron supplementation is a method of delivering iron by infusion with a needle into a vein. What is intravenous iron supplementation? One way of treating iron-deficiency anemia is by eating foods that are high in iron. You can then be treated for both the anemia and its cause. Your doctor must first find out if the anemia is being caused by a poor diet or a more serious health problem. Your healthcare provider will decide on the proper treatment, depending on the type of anemia and what is causing it. If these levels are low, the doctor can make a diagnosis of anemia. The blood tests will measure your hemoglobin and how much iron is in your body. The type and number of blood tests will depend on what type of anemia your doctor thinks you might have. Your healthcare provider can perform blood tests to tell if you have anemia.
